Forklifts have many tire options. Cushion, air pneumatic, solid pneumatic and foam-filled are just a number of these. Again, understanding your application will help ascertain the proper tire for your forklift. If you are working mostly indoors, on cement or asphalt then a pillow tire will do. These tires are also available in a non-marking design, which will retain black marks off the floor. If you are working out on rough asphalt, in gravel, mud or grass you'll need a pneumatic tire. These tires have actual tread and include more of a cushion between the forklift and the ground. Keep in mind that forklifts do not come with their own suspension. The tires on your own unit can considerably influence the comfort of your own operators. Aftermarket tires that use longer are also offered. Consult your regional dealer to your best options.

Another reason to utilize automated washers is that they accumulate the dirty water in a tank so it can be processed. Used wash water is contaminated with acid and heavy metals such as lead and copper. Lead is a specific concern since a couple of oz of lead can contaminate thousands and thousands of gallons of groundwater. Businesses that let wash water go down the drain or dip into the ground aren't only damaging the surroundings but are susceptible to significant financial penalties.
Renting a forklift is the ideal solution for solving temporary gear deficit problems. A forklift rental can be a dream come true during times when there's an exceptionally large workload or temporary projects will need to get finished. There are a number of companies that rent out forklifts, from building equipment companies to car rental agencies. Forklifts can be rented for any length of time, sometimes up to a number of years. Renters can find any sort of forklift they want to find in order to complete any sort of work. People can rent forklifts for indoor warehouse use or for use in a rugged outdoor setting.

Extra features practically always add value to a forklift. As an example, if your forklift includes a computerized control panel rather than a standard manual one, this may add value. Other features which add value include scales that weigh your loads automatically and in transit, attachments offered together with the forklift, and air conditioned cabs, to mention a few. Essentially, anything that doesn't come standard on a new model is considered an additional quality that adds value.
